Before diving right into the ins and outs of community philanthropy, it is first of all vital to comprehend what it means. Community philanthropy refers to the method of giving money, time and resources to local developing communities. Unlike large-scale philanthropy, which tackles international issues, community philanthropy is based on the idea that it is the people who actually live in that area that best understand its difficulties and are most equipped to create purposeful solutions. This is why one of the main advantages of community philanthropy is that it is a joint effort between both the community members and the philanthropist, which increases a feeling of team spirit and social bonding. In terms of how to help the local community, one of the most powerful approaches is through financial donations. It does not matter exactly how big the monetary contribution is; even small percentages can be valuable and make a difference. Ultimately, supporting local charities through financial contributions is an effective way to improve the prosperity, health and wellbeing of the population in the community, as people like Alexander Berger would understand. Philanthropists can either donate directly to regional charities, like food banks or after-school programs, or they can develop community funds which disperse grants to numerous organisations.
